Skip to content
体验新版
项目
组织
正在加载...
登录
切换导航
打开侧边栏
OpenHarmony
Docs
提交
b219097f
D
Docs
项目概览
OpenHarmony
/
Docs
大约 1 年 前同步成功
通知
159
Star
292
Fork
28
代码
文件
提交
分支
Tags
贡献者
分支图
Diff
Issue
0
列表
看板
标记
里程碑
合并请求
0
Wiki
0
Wiki
分析
仓库
DevOps
项目成员
Pages
D
Docs
项目概览
项目概览
详情
发布
仓库
仓库
文件
提交
分支
标签
贡献者
分支图
比较
Issue
0
Issue
0
列表
看板
标记
里程碑
合并请求
0
合并请求
0
Pages
分析
分析
仓库分析
DevOps
Wiki
0
Wiki
成员
成员
收起侧边栏
关闭侧边栏
动态
分支图
创建新Issue
提交
Issue看板
未验证
提交
b219097f
编写于
8月 17, 2022
作者:
O
openharmony_ci
提交者:
Gitee
8月 17, 2022
浏览文件
操作
浏览文件
下载
差异文件
!7958 update docs
Merge pull request !7958 from 关明月/master
上级
76a0a2cf
936bb4f5
变更
10
隐藏空白更改
内联
并排
Showing
10 changed file
with
38 addition
and
32 deletion
+38
-32
zh-cn/application-dev/reference/apis/js-apis-system-router.md
...n/application-dev/reference/apis/js-apis-system-router.md
+11
-11
zh-cn/application-dev/reference/arkui-js/js-components-custom-lifecycle.md
...-dev/reference/arkui-js/js-components-custom-lifecycle.md
+10
-10
zh-cn/application-dev/reference/arkui-ts/ts-basic-gestures-pangesture.md
...on-dev/reference/arkui-ts/ts-basic-gestures-pangesture.md
+1
-1
zh-cn/application-dev/reference/arkui-ts/ts-container-grid.md
...n/application-dev/reference/arkui-ts/ts-container-grid.md
+1
-1
zh-cn/application-dev/reference/arkui-ts/ts-container-list.md
...n/application-dev/reference/arkui-ts/ts-container-list.md
+3
-1
zh-cn/application-dev/reference/arkui-ts/ts-container-scroll.md
...application-dev/reference/arkui-ts/ts-container-scroll.md
+3
-2
zh-cn/application-dev/reference/arkui-ts/ts-drawing-components-path.md
...tion-dev/reference/arkui-ts/ts-drawing-components-path.md
+1
-1
zh-cn/application-dev/reference/arkui-ts/ts-methods-custom-dialog-box.md
...on-dev/reference/arkui-ts/ts-methods-custom-dialog-box.md
+3
-0
zh-cn/application-dev/reference/arkui-ts/ts-transition-animation-component.md
...v/reference/arkui-ts/ts-transition-animation-component.md
+3
-3
zh-cn/application-dev/ui/ui-ts-layout-mediaquery.md
zh-cn/application-dev/ui/ui-ts-layout-mediaquery.md
+2
-2
未找到文件。
zh-cn/application-dev/reference/apis/js-apis-system-router.md
浏览文件 @
b219097f
...
...
@@ -374,12 +374,12 @@ export default {
**系统能力:**
以下各项对应的系统能力均为SystemCapability.ArkUI.ArkUI.Full
| 名称
| 参数类型 | 必填 | 说明
|
| -------- | ------------------------ | ---- | ------------------------- |
| message | string | 是
| 询问对话框内容。
|
| success | (errMsg: string) => void | 否
| 弹出对话框时调用,errMsg表示返回信息。
|
|
fail | (errMsg: string) => void | 否 | 接口调用失败的回调函数
,errMsg表示返回信息。 |
| complete | () => void | 否
| 接口调用结束的回调函数。
|
| 名称
| 参数类型 | 必填 | 说明
|
| -------- | ------------------------ | ---- | -------------------------
-------------------------
|
| message | string | 是
| 询问对话框内容。
|
| success | (errMsg: string) => void | 否
| 用户选择对话框确认按钮时触发,errMsg表示返回信息。
|
|
cancel | (errMsg: string) => void | 否 | 用户选择对话框取消按钮时触发
,errMsg表示返回信息。 |
| complete | () => void | 否
| 接口调用结束的回调函数。
|
## DisableAlertBeforeBackPageOptions<sup>6+</sup>
...
...
@@ -387,11 +387,11 @@ export default {
**系统能力:**
以下各项对应的系统能力均为SystemCapability.ArkUI.ArkUI.Full
| 名称
| 参数类型 | 必填 | 说明
|
| -------- | ------------------------ | ---- | ------------------------- |
| success | (errMsg: string) => void | 否
| 弹出对话框时调用,errMsg表示返回信息。
|
|
fail | (errMsg: string) => void | 否 | 接口调用失败的回调函数
,errMsg表示返回信息。 |
| complete | () => void | 否
| 接口调用结束的回调函数。
|
| 名称
| 参数类型 | 必填 | 说明
|
| -------- | ------------------------ | ---- | -------------------------
-------------------------
|
| success | (errMsg: string) => void | 否
| 关闭询问对话框能力成功时触发,errMsg表示返回信息。
|
|
cancel | (errMsg: string) => void | 否 | 关闭询问对话框能力失败时触发
,errMsg表示返回信息。 |
| complete | () => void | 否
| 接口调用结束的回调函数。
|
## ParamsInterface
...
...
zh-cn/application-dev/reference/arkui-js/js-components-custom-lifecycle.md
浏览文件 @
b219097f
...
...
@@ -7,15 +7,15 @@
我们为自定义组件提供了一系列生命周期回调方法,便于开发者管理自定义组件的内部逻辑。生命周期主要包括:onInit,onAttached,onDetached,onLayoutReady,onDestroy,onPageShow和onPageHide。下面我们依次介绍一下各个生命周期回调的时机。
| 属性
| 类型 | 描述 | 触发时机
|
| ------------- | -------- | -----------
|
---------------------------------------- |
| onInit | Function | 初始化自定义组件
| 自定义组件初始化生命周期回调,当自定义组件创建时,触发该回调,主要用于自定义组件中必须使用的数据初始化,该回调只会触发一次调用。 |
| 属性
| 类型 | 描述 | 触发时机
|
| ------------- | -------- | -----------
------- | --------------------
---------------------------------------- |
| onInit | Function | 初始化自定义组件 | 自定义组件初始化生命周期回调,当自定义组件创建时,触发该回调,主要用于自定义组件中必须使用的数据初始化,该回调只会触发一次调用。 |
| onAttached | Function | 自定义组件装载 | 自定义组件被创建后,加入到Page组件树时,触发该回调,该回调触发时,表示组件将被进行显示,该生命周期可用于初始化显示相关数据,通常用于加载图片资源、开始执行动画等场景。 |
| onLayoutReady | Function | 自定义组件布局完成
| 自定义组件插入Page组件树后,将会对自定义组件进行布局计算,调整其内容元素尺寸与位置,当布局计算结束后触发该回调。 |
| onDetached | Function | 自定义组件摘除 | 自定义组件摘除时,触发该回调,常用于停止动画或异步逻辑停止执行的场景。
|
| onDestroy | Function | 自定义组件销毁 | 自定义组件销毁时,触发该回调,常用于资源释放。
|
| on
PageShow | Function | 自定义组件Page显示 | 自定义组件所在Page显示后,触发该回调。
|
| on
PageHide | Function | 自定义组件Page隐藏 | 自定义组件所在Page隐藏后,触发该回调。
|
| onLayoutReady | Function | 自定义组件布局完成 | 自定义组件插入Page组件树后,将会对自定义组件进行布局计算,调整其内容元素尺寸与位置,当布局计算结束后触发该回调。 |
| onDetached | Function | 自定义组件摘除 | 自定义组件摘除时,触发该回调,常用于停止动画或异步逻辑停止执行的场景。 |
| onDestroy | Function | 自定义组件销毁 | 自定义组件销毁时,触发该回调,常用于资源释放。 |
| on
Show | Function | 自定义组件Page显示 | 自定义组件所在Page显示后,触发该回调。
|
| on
Hide | Function | 自定义组件Page隐藏 | 自定义组件所在Page隐藏后,触发该回调。
|
## 示例
...
...
@@ -42,10 +42,10 @@ export default {
onDetached
()
{
this
.
value
=
""
},
on
Page
Show
()
{
onShow
()
{
console
.
log
(
"
Page显示
"
)
},
on
Page
Hide
()
{
onHide
()
{
console
.
log
(
"
Page隐藏
"
)
}
}
...
...
zh-cn/application-dev/reference/arkui-ts/ts-basic-gestures-pangesture.md
浏览文件 @
b219097f
...
...
@@ -20,7 +20,7 @@ PanGesture(options?: { fingers?: number, direction?: PanDirection, distance?: nu
| -------- | -------- | -------- | -------- | -------- |
| fingers | number | 否 | 1 | 触发滑动的最少手指数,最小为1指,
最大取值为10指。 |
| direction | PanDirection | 否 | All | 设置滑动方向,此枚举值支持逻辑与(
&
)和逻辑或(
\|
)运算。 |
| distance | number | 否 | 5.0 | 最小滑动识别距离,单位为vp。 |
| distance | number | 否 | 5.0 | 最小滑动识别距离,单位为vp。
<br/>
**说明:**
<br/>
> tab滑动与该拖动手势事件同时存在时,可将distance值设为1,使拖动更灵敏,避免造成事件错乱。
|
-
PanDirection枚举说明
| 名称 | 描述 |
...
...
zh-cn/application-dev/reference/arkui-ts/ts-container-grid.md
浏览文件 @
b219097f
...
...
@@ -20,7 +20,7 @@
## 接口
Grid(
value:{scroller?: Scroller}
)
Grid(
scroller?: Scroller
)
-
参数
| 参数名 | 参数类型 | 必填 | 默认值 | 参数描述 |
...
...
zh-cn/application-dev/reference/arkui-ts/ts-container-list.md
浏览文件 @
b219097f
# List
> **说明:**
> 该组件从API Version 7开始支持。后续版本如有新增内容,则采用上角标单独标记该内容的起始版本。
>
> - 该组件从API Version 7开始支持。后续版本如有新增内容,则采用上角标单独标记该内容的起始版本。
> - 该组件回弹的前提是要有滚动。内容小于一屏时,没有回弹效果。
列表包含一系列相同宽度的列表项。适合连续、多行呈现同类数据,例如图片和文本。
...
...
zh-cn/application-dev/reference/arkui-ts/ts-container-scroll.md
浏览文件 @
b219097f
# Scroll
> **说明:**
> - 该组件从API version 7开始支持。后续版本如有新增内容,则采用上角标单独标记该内容的起始版本。
> - 该组件嵌套List子组件滚动时,若List不设置宽高,则默认全部加载,在对性能有要求的场景下建议指定List的宽高。
> - 该组件从API version 7开始支持。后续版本如有新增内容,则采用上角标单独标记该内容的起始版本。
> - 该组件嵌套List子组件滚动时,若List不设置宽高,则默认全部加载,在对性能有要求的场景下建议指定List的宽高。
> - 该组件回弹的前提是要有滚动。内容小于一屏时,没有回弹效果。
可滚动的容器组件,当子组件的布局尺寸超过父组件的视口时,内容可以滚动。
...
...
zh-cn/application-dev/reference/arkui-ts/ts-drawing-components-path.md
浏览文件 @
b219097f
...
...
@@ -15,7 +15,7 @@
无
# 接口
#
#
接口
Path(value?: { width?: number | string; height?: number | string; commands?: string })
...
...
zh-cn/application-dev/reference/arkui-ts/ts-methods-custom-dialog-box.md
浏览文件 @
b219097f
...
...
@@ -6,6 +6,9 @@
> 从API Version 7开始支持。后续版本如有新增内容,则采用上角标单独标记该内容的起始版本。
通过CustomDialogController类显示自定义弹窗。使用弹窗组件时,可优先考虑自定义弹窗,便于自定义弹窗的样式与内容。
## 接口
CustomDialogController(value:{builder: CustomDialog, cancel?: () =
>
void, autoCancel?: boolean, alignment?: DialogAlignment, offset?: Offset, customStyle?: boolean})
...
...
zh-cn/application-dev/reference/arkui-ts/ts-transition-animation-component.md
浏览文件 @
b219097f
...
...
@@ -18,9 +18,9 @@
| -------- | -------- | -------- | -------- | -------- |
| type | TransitionType | TransitionType.All | 否 | 默认包括组件新增和删除。
<br/>
>
**说明:**
<br/>
>
不指定Type时说明插入删除使用同一种效果。 |
| opacity | number | 1 | 否 | 设置组件转场时的透明度效果,为插入时起点和删除时终点的值。 |
| translate | {
<br/>
x?
:
number,
<br/>
y?
:
number,
<br/>
z?
:
number
<br/>
} | - | 否 | 设置组件转场时的平移效果,为插入时起点和删除时终点的值。 |
| scale | {
<br/>
x?
:
number,
<br/>
y?
:
number,
<br/>
z?
:
number,
<br/>
centerX?
:
number,
<br/>
centerY?
:
number
<br/>
} | - | 否 | 设置组件转场时的缩放效果,为插入时起点和删除时终点的值。
<br/>
**说明:**
<br/>
>
中心点为0时,默认的是组件的左上角
<br/>
>
centerX、centerY设置百分比时,是基于自身布局的尺寸缩放的
|
| rotate | {
<br/>
x?:
number,
<br/>
y?:
number,
<br/>
z?:
number,
<br/>
angle?:
Angle,
<br/>
centerX?:
Length,
<br/>
centerY?:
Length
<br/>
} | - | 否 | 设置组件转场时的旋转效果,为插入时起点和删除时终点的值。
<br/>
**说明:**
<br/>
>
中心点为0时,默认的是组件的左上角 |
| translate | {
<br/>
x?
:
number,
<br/>
y?
:
number,
<br/>
z?
:
number
<br/>
} | - | 否 | 设置组件转场时的平移效果,为插入时起点和删除时终点的值。
<br/>
**说明:**
<br/>
>
x、y、z分别是横向、纵向、竖向的平移距离
|
| scale | {
<br/>
x?
:
number,
<br/>
y?
:
number,
<br/>
z?
:
number,
<br/>
centerX?
:
number,
<br/>
centerY?
:
number
<br/>
} | - | 否 | 设置组件转场时的缩放效果,为插入时起点和删除时终点的值。
<br/>
**说明:**
<br/>
>
x、y、z分别是横向、纵向、竖向放大倍数(或缩小到原来的多少)
<br/>
>
centerX、centerY缩放中心点
<br/>
>
中心点为0时,默认的是组件的左上角
<br/>
|
| rotate | {
<br/>
x?:
number,
<br/>
y?:
number,
<br/>
z?:
number,
<br/>
angle?:
Angle,
<br/>
centerX?:
Length,
<br/>
centerY?:
Length
<br/>
} | - | 否 | 设置组件转场时的旋转效果,为插入时起点和删除时终点的值。
<br/>
**说明:**
<br/>
>
x、y、z分别是横向、纵向、竖向的旋转向量
<br/>
>
centerX,centerY指旋转中心点
<br/>
>
中心点为0时,默认的是组件的左上角 |
-
TransitionType枚举说明
| 名称 | 描述 |
...
...
zh-cn/application-dev/ui/ui-ts-layout-mediaquery.md
浏览文件 @
b219097f
...
...
@@ -43,9 +43,9 @@ listener.on('change', onPortrait)
`(max-height: 800)`
:当高度小于800时条件成立
`(height
<= 800) `
:当高度小
于800时条件成立
`(height
<= 800) `
:当高度小于等
于800时条件成立
`screen and (device-type: tv) or (resolution
<
2)`
:包含多个媒体特征的多条件复杂语句查询
`screen and (device-type: tv) or (resolution
<
2)`
:包含多个媒体特征的多条件复杂语句查询
### 媒体类型(media-type)
...
...
编辑
预览
Markdown
is supported
0%
请重试
或
添加新附件
.
添加附件
取消
You are about to add
0
people
to the discussion. Proceed with caution.
先完成此消息的编辑!
取消
想要评论请
注册
或
登录